Property Description
This charming semi-rural home beautifully combines traditional character with modern fixtures and fittings. Immaculately presented throughout, it offers move-in-ready accommodation surrounded by scenic countryside walks and picturesque views.
A low stone boundary wall, attractive partial stone frontage, and well-maintained front garden create excellent kerb appeal. The property is entered via a welcoming porch and hallway, leading to a cosy lounge featuring an exposed brick fireplace and delightful countryside views to the front.
To the rear, the open-plan kitchen and dining area is fitted with a range of contemporary units and integrated cooking appliances, providing an ideal space for both everyday living and entertaining. A convenient ground floor WC completes the downstairs accommodation.
On the first floor are two well-proportioned bedrooms, with the principal bedroom enjoying attractive views across the surrounding countryside. A stylish family bathroom, fitted with a modern white suite, completes the accommodation.
Outside, the property benefits from an enclosed rear yard, while across the rear access road there is a hardstanding area providing off-street parking. Further benefits include double glazing throughout and an energy-efficient air source heat pump.
Quebec is a charming semi-rural village set amidst beautiful countryside, while remaining conveniently located within easy reach of Lanchester, Esh Winning and Langley Park, all of which offer a good selection of everyday shops, schools and local amenities. The historic city of Durham is approximately seven miles away, providing an extensive range of shopping, leisure and recreational facilities, together with excellent transport links.
